The Fine Print Nobody Reads (But You Should)

I am going to be honest with you. I hate reading terms and conditions. But I forced myself to read this one because I wanted to see if there were any hidden traps.

Term Value
Minimum Deposit $10
Max Bonus Amount $200
Wagering Requirement 35x bonus
Max Bet with Bonus $5 per spin
Game Contribution Pokies 100%, Table Games 10%
Max Cashout from Bonus $500
Time Limit 30 days

One thing that caught my eye. The “max cashout from bonus” is $500. That means if you hit a massive win using bonus funds, you can only keep $500 of it. The rest gets deducted. It is a bit stingy, but most Aussie casinos have this rule now. I don’t love it, but I understand why they do it.

FAQ: Common Questions About Bingo Welcome Bonuses

Can I withdraw the bingo welcome bonus immediately?

No. You cannot withdraw the bonus money itself. You have to wager it first. Usually, the wagering requirement is between 20x and 40x the bonus amount. After you meet that, any winnings become withdrawable.

What is the best deposit method for Aussie players?

PayID is the best in my opinion. It is instant, free, and widely accepted. POLi is also good but sometimes has fees. Credit cards work but some banks block gambling transactions. I recommend PayID for deposits and withdrawals.

Are bingo welcome bonuses worth it for pokies players?

Yes. Most bingo welcome bonuses can be used on pokies. Just check the terms to see which games contribute to the wagering requirement. Usually, pokies contribute 100%. Some table games contribute less or zero.

How long does it take to get the bonus after deposit?

In my experience, it is instant. As soon as the deposit clears, the bonus funds appear in your account. If you need a promo code, make sure to enter it during the deposit process. If you forget, contact support and they might add it manually.

Can I get multiple welcome bonuses?

Usually no. Most casinos offer one welcome bonus per person, per household, per IP address. If you try to claim multiple bonuses with different accounts, you will get caught during KYC and your winnings will be voided. Do not risk it.
